Once upon a time there was a poor


woodcutter. He was very poor but he was
always honest. One hot day, he took his axe
and went inside the nearby forest in search of
wood. After searching for a long time, he found
one good tree near a river inside the forest.

“Hmmm…this tree is good. I can get lots of


firewood”
 So, the woodcutter started to work.
„Swish, swoosh, swish swoosh.”
 
„Plop..”
 
Oh no! As the woodcutter was cutting the
woods, his axe slipped from his hands and fell
inside the river. The river was very deep. So he
couldn't get into the water to take his axe out.
He started crying.
“Oh..oh.. what am I going to do?”
 “I have lost my precious axe. Oh dear, oh
dear.”
 
Suddenly, a beautiful angel appeared from
inside the river water.
“Why are crying my dear woodcutter?”
 She asked.

“Oh, I have lost my axe…now I won‟t be able


to cut woods anymore.”
The woodcutter told her how his axe fell inside
the water.

The angel went inside


the water and after sometime came out with a 
golden axe in her hands. The woodcutter
refused to accept that golden axe.

The angel again went inside the water. This


time she came out with a silver axe and gave it
to the woodcutter. Again the woodcutter
refused saying that his was not a silver axe.
The angel dived into the water.

This time she came out with the woodcutter's


iron axe. The woodcutter happily accepted his
axe and thanked the angel.

The angel was pleased with his honesty. The


angel rewarded the gold and the silver axes to
that woodcutter.

MORAL: Honesty always gets rewarded.
